US lifts duties on stainless steel sheet and strip from Germany and Italy
US lifts duties on stainless steel sheet and strip from Germany and Italy

12/08/2011

The United States International Trade Commission (ITC) has decided to revoke the duties imposed on stainless steel sheet and strip in coils from Germany and Italy. The US were the second biggest market for EU steel exports in 2010, a sector whose exports are estimated at 32 billion euro. Lifting the duty against European exports would resolve one of the EU’s long standing trade irritants with the US.

India: Interim dumping duty imposed on opal glassware from China, UAE
India: Interim dumping duty imposed on opal glassware from China, UAE

12/08/2011

The Finance Ministry has imposed provisional anti-dumping duty on ‘opal glassware’ imports from China and the United Arab Emirates (UAE). This duty will be valid for a period of six months, the Revenue Department has said.
